你查询的IP:[123.101.172.36]  地理位置:中国–河南–驻马店

最新查询123.137.163.187 218.77.215.55 125.62.95.176 118.126.236.65 59.80.26.63 116.196.81.25 121.192.166.164 218.70.90.148 221.234.192.95 123.101.172.36 116.207.217.95 210.21.160.211 220.152.128.89 117.121.192.240 122.198.112.104 118.230.224.1 220.252.224.244 117.58.135.171 123.103.147.46 210.79.224.44 203.110.160.186 203.18.50.143 119.42.211.131 203.161.192.189 202.90.224.159 124.156.225.255 203.110.160.57 124.156.149.174 116.76.31.220 202.70.193.239 119.144.239.233